Fexofenadine is a peripheral H1-receptor antagonist that selectively inhibits histamine-mediated effects on H1 receptors, reducing allergic symptoms. It does not penetrate the blood-brain barrier significantly, minimizing sedation.
Olopatadine hydrochloride is a selective histamine H1 receptor antagonist and mast cell stabilizer. It inhibits histamine release from mast cells and prevents histamine-induced effects such as increased vascular permeability and pruritus.
